**Audit item 14: Websocket reconnect bug (Chatterdeck)**

Verify the reconnect storm fix is still holding — clients should back off exponentially, not hammer the gateway every 500ms like before. Check the reconnect-rate dashboard; anything over 50/sec per node is a red flag. If it regresses, page immediately. Questions go to the engineer listed below.

approver of yajef-fajef = Oliwyn Silion Kasok Kasox

Hello plugin authors,

Next Thursday, Corbexa will run a disaster-recovery drill for the RestockRoute vending-machine restock planner. During the failover window, plugin callbacks will be replayed against the standby scheduler, so please ensure your handlers are idempotent and tolerate duplicate route assignments. No customer restock data will be altered. To re-register your plugin against the standby environment during the drill, authenticate with the recovery passphrase provided below.

vault phrase of hahip-tajeg = quenax-briath-briax

Break-glass access: SquatWatch

Quick notes for the weekly sync. SquatWatch is our typo-squatting package scanner; if it goes dark, malicious lookalike packages can slip into the Pellbrook registry, so we keep a break-glass path. Use it only when both regular admins are unreachable and the scanner has been down 30+ minutes. Grab the sealed envelope from the ops locker, log the incident in #squatwatch-alerts, and ping whoever's on call. The break-glass login prompts for the passphrase below.

unlock words, tagaf-tawif: quenys-zordor-aldius-caswyn

- [ ] **Tile cache warm-up (Marrowlight v2.9)** — Flush the Pindle tile-rendering cache on both edge pools before promoting. Run the warmer against the Corven basemap set, confirm hit rate exceeds 90% on the canary, then unpin the old cache keys. New folks: do not skip the canary step; stale tiles are hard to spot. Record the build that passed warm-up using the token below.

build token for fajof-yahof: htk4_869f

Heads up: this alert fires when the Stormbeacon fan-out lags more than 90 seconds behind the upstream weather feed. Stormbeacon pushes severe-weather notices to every regional shard at once, so a stall here means folks in the Calderone region might get a flood warning late — not great. From a security angle, the usual culprit is an expired signing cert on the relay, not an attack. Triage steps and the cert rotation checklist live on the internal page here.

dashboard of hadug-fawep = https://artifactory.braskhq.test/deploy